Challenges in Scaling Bottle Filling Operations
Scaling bottle filling operations comes with a unique set of challenges that can impact efficiency, quality, and compliance if not properly addressed. Understanding these obstacles is the first step toward implementing effective solutions that support sustainable growth.
Maintaining Dose Accuracy at Scale
As production accelerates, the challenge of maintaining precise dosing becomes magnified. High-speed operations can introduce variability, especially if legacy equipment isn’t designed for such capacity. Inaccurate dosing is not just a technical fault; it’s a compliance risk and a patient safety issue.
To counter this, manufacturers must adopt advanced pharmaceutical bottle filling machines equipped with real-time monitoring, automated adjustments, and precision-engineered components. Technologies like servo-driven fillers and mass flow meters offer superior control, ensuring every unit meets exact specifications regardless of volume.
Ensuring Sterility Across Expanded Operations
With greater production volumes comes increased potential for contamination risks. Sterility is non-negotiable in pharmaceutical manufacturing. As facilities scale, maintaining aseptic conditions across larger environments and more complex equipment setups becomes a significant operational hurdle.
Investing in isolator technology, advanced HEPA filtration, and equipment designed for CIP (Clean-in-Place) and SIP (Sterilize-in-Place) protocols is essential. Regular validation and environmental monitoring must also scale in tandem with production to ensure consistent compliance.
Navigating Regulatory Compliance
Regulatory compliance becomes more complex as operations grow. Each additional process or piece of equipment introduces new variables that must meet stringent industry standards. Manufacturers need to stay ahead of these requirements to avoid costly delays or penalties.
Implementing digital solutions such as Manufacturing Execution Systems (MES) and Electronic Batch Records (EBR) can streamline compliance efforts, reduce manual errors, and provide real-time data for audits.
Achieving Seamless System Integration
Effective scaling relies on the ability to integrate new technologies without disrupting existing workflows. Poor integration can lead to inefficiencies, data mismanagement, and production delays. Planning for interoperability is key to maintaining smooth operations during growth phases.
Opting for modular, interoperable equipment and leveraging Industrial Internet of Things (IIoT) technologies can unify production processes. Centralized control systems and standardized communication protocols, such as OPC UA, ensure cohesive operation across all machinery and software platforms.

Strategies for Scaling Bottle Filling Equipment
To overcome the challenges of scaling, pharmaceutical manufacturers need a clear strategy that focuses on flexibility, efficiency, and compliance. The following approaches provide a roadmap for expanding bottle filling operations without sacrificing quality or productivity.
Conduct Thorough Operational Assessments
A successful scaling initiative begins with a deep understanding of current capabilities and limitations. Conducting detailed process mapping, capacity analysis, and risk assessments will highlight inefficiencies and areas where upgrades are most impactful.
Engage cross-functional teams, including engineering, quality assurance, and regulatory affairs, to ensure all perspectives are considered when designing a scalable solution.
Invest in Flexible, Modular Equipment Solutions
Modern pharmaceutical bottle filling machines are designed with scalability in mind. Modular systems allow manufacturers to expand capacity by adding components rather than replacing entire lines. This approach reduces capital expenditure and minimizes disruption.
Look for equipment that offers quick changeover features, adjustable fill volumes, and compatibility with various container types to support diverse product portfolios.
Prioritize Automation and Smart Technology
Automation is no longer a luxury; it is essential for scalable pharmaceutical production. Automated systems reduce dependency on manual labor, enhance precision, and improve overall equipment effectiveness (OEE). Integrating smart sensors, AI-driven analytics, and predictive maintenance tools can further optimize performance and preempt potential issues.
Automated inspection systems, for example, ensure continuous quality control without slowing down production.
